How do I calibrate my hygrometer?

You’re looking to monitor your moisture. Good move. Maintaining appropriate RH levels is fundamental in caring and preserving your instrument.

With this step-by-step video below, we’ll show you exactly how calibration is done, but hygrometer calibration couldn’t be easier.

  1. Using the Boveda One-Step Hygrometer Calibration Kit, place your hygrometer inside the bag and close the seal.
  2. Let the hygrometer sit in the Calibration Kit for at least 24 hours at room temperature (65 to 75°F/19.5 to 23.5°C).
  3. Your hygrometer should read the same RH% level stated on the kit (either 32% or 75%). It’s possible that there’s a slight difference–just note it for future readings, or adjust your hygrometer if that’s a possibility.
